Endowment Funds

An endowed fund will exist in perpetuity, and spending from the fund is controlled by a spending policy. In short, our current spending policy is that 5% of the market value of the fund, based on a 20-quarter rolling average, becomes spendable each year, and that amount if unused remains spendable in the future. Gifts to endowed funds qualify for a federal income tax deduction and also for the Michigan Community Foundation Tax Credit.

Unrestricted Endowment Funds

These funds provide earnings that the Board of Trustees of the Clare County Community Foundation can use for its discretionary grantmaking and project development. The creation of this type of fund is also a wonderful way for a family to honor a loved one by creating a permanent fund which will carry his/her name in perpetuity.

Other Unrestricted Endowment Funds

These are funds which honor or memorialize individuals or families, or were started by a group/company/organization, but which are also part of our group of unrestricted endowment funds. The donors who established these funds have provided to us the highest possible complement -- they believe that we will find the highest and best use for their dollars at the appropriate time.

Donor-advised Endowment Funds

These funds are technically unrestricted funds from which the donor (an individual, family, business, corporation, organization or foundation) advises the Foundation Board of Trustees in grantmaking. The following are endowed, donor-advised funds.
